Creating a Class Type
From the Home screen ~
- Classes -> Add Type
- Class Type ID: The Class Type ID is limited to 10 characters. No spaces or special characters (except an underscore) are allowed.
- Display Name: Enter the common name for the class. This will be visible to your member on the Member Portal as well as the Mobile App
- Description: Enter a brief description of the class
- Session Charge: This defaults to one as 1 session charged is the norm.
- Priority: Setting a priority on your class will determine its place on the screen. The higher the priority, the closer to the top of the screen it will be
- Session Length (min): Enter the minimum length the class can be
- Payroll Code: If your Instructors are paid a different amount per class. **For more on Payroll Codes, see the Trainer Payroll Configuration document.
- Class Sub-type: Normal or Group Training.
- Normal - only apply class charge to trainer payroll.
- Group Training - apply class charge to trainer payroll AND apply individuals to trainer payroll
- Price: Entering a price is only necessary if the class is sold online to non-members.
- Member Can View: Enable this setting to yes if you are using the Member Portal or Member App for online class scheduling
- Padding Time: Add padding time if you need extra time after the class for cleanup or instructor breaks
- Apply Class Charge to Trainer Payroll:
- Class Category. Categories are defined in Tools -> System Settings -> Field Definitions -> Class Categories. Grouping similar Class Types under a single category provides more functional filtering for the Member online.
- Allow one class registration per day. This setting will limit how many times a Member can sign up for the same Class Type in a single day. For example, if you offer a very popular Yoga class 3 times a day, a Member may want to sign up for all of them but only go to the one that best suits their schedule. This may cause an issue for capacity restricted classes.
- Max number of members on waitlist. Leave it blank for unlimited members
- You can now add an image to your Class Types. This is a nice touch for your online class schedule. Click Browse to search for the image. Upload, then Save.
**Optional settings
- Weekday cancel cut-off in hours: Use only if this specific class has different cancel cut-off hours from you System Settings during the week.
- Weekend cancel cut-off in hours: Use only if this specific class has different cancel cut-off hours from you System Settings during the week.
